Output e4e315c81f9168de00c85180d0d3c8e332d3c4d41a1c8d22f05bacbcb76ff4ae:0

value
655200
script pubkey
OP_0 OP_PUSHBYTES_20 caad940158921e7fd3added95b452f3903abdcda
address
bc1qe2kegq2cjg08l5admmv4k3f08yp6hhx6u3rxa5
transaction
e4e315c81f9168de00c85180d0d3c8e332d3c4d41a1c8d22f05bacbcb76ff4ae
confirmations
9055
spent
true